Bridgehampton 400 km race 1962, 2nd race
The second 400 km race of Bridgehampton 1962 , also Double 400, Bridgehampton , took place on September 16, 1962 at the Bridgehampton Race Circuit and was the 14th round of the sports car world championship of that year.
The race
One day after the GT car race, another championship race of the 1962 World Sports Car Championship took place on the Bridgehampton circuit . This time GT and racing cars over 2 liters were eligible to compete. After driving almost three hours, Pedro Rodríguez won in a Ferrari 330TRI / LM with two laps ahead of Bob Grossman in a Ferrari 250 GTO .

Racing data
- Registered: 25
- Started: 20
- Valued: 12
- Race classes: 3
- Spectators: 15,000
- Race day weather: cold and dry
- Route length: 4.603 km
- Driving time of the winning team: 2: 47: 48,000 hours
- Total laps of the winning team: 87
- Total distance of the winning team: 400.437 km
- Winner's average: 143.183 km / h
- Pole position: Pedro Rodríguez - Ferrari 330TRI / LM (8) - 1: 49.600 = 151.185 km / h
- Fastest race lap: Pedro Rodríguez - Ferrari 330TRI / LM (8) - 1: 50.200 = 150.361 km / h
- Racing series: 14th round of the 1962 World Sports Car Championship
